Identification & Analysis of Parameters for Program Quality Improvement: A Reengineering Perspective

Abstract

The nature of software development is very dynamic and more complex by the perspective of reengineering or further program maintenances so the developed programs must be flexible, reusable and more scalable and which will be possible by the optimum quality parameters satisfaction. Having these issues in concern the software development houses trying to find out some established, usable methods to improve the quality of programs, the work presented in this paper is to identify, describe and analyze various parameters for quality which can affect the productivity and reusability of the software program and its future maintenance in form of reengineering. The work presented also analyzes the literature, previous research with different aspects and issues, and discussed its affects on present quality of the program because it is necessary to consider the potential impact on other requirements when designing a program to meet quality parameters requirements. Quality parameters are the overall factors that affect run-time behavior, system design, and user experience because many of these parameters are major concern to the program design and architecture, and also applied to establish  program functionality, reusability, performance, reliability, and security which indicates the success of the design and the overall quality of the program and its application, integration. Keywords: AOSD, DoD, FURPS,LOC,Parameters

    Similar works